luci/applications/luci-app-banip/root/usr/share/rpcd/acl.d/luci-app-banip.json
Dirk Brenken df9549e6bd
luci-app-banip: sync with banIP 0.8.2-4
Signed-off-by: Dirk Brenken <dev@brenken.org>
2023-03-26 23:00:51 +02:00

76 lines
1.2 KiB
JSON

{
"luci-app-banip": {
"description": "Grant access to LuCI app banIP",
"write": {
"uci": [
"banip"
],
"file": {
"/etc/banip/*": [
"read"
],
"/etc/banip/banip.allowlist": [
"write"
],
"/etc/banip/banip.blocklist": [
"write"
],
"/etc/banip/banip.feeds": [
"read"
]
}
},
"read": {
"cgi-io": [
"exec"
],
"file": {
"/var/run/banip.pid": [
"read"
],
"/var/run/banip_runtime.json": [
"read"
],
"/sbin/logread -e banIP-": [
"exec"
],
"/usr/sbin/logread -e banIP-": [
"exec"
],
"/sbin/logread -e banIP/": [
"exec"
],
"/usr/sbin/logread -e banIP/": [
"exec"
],
"/usr/sbin/nft -tj list ruleset": [
"exec"
],
"/etc/init.d/banip stop": [
"exec"
],
"/etc/init.d/banip reload": [
"exec"
],
"/etc/init.d/banip restart": [
"exec"
],
"/etc/init.d/banip report json": [
"exec"
],
"/etc/init.d/banip search *": [
"exec"
],
"/etc/init.d/banip survey *": [
"exec"
],
"/etc/init.d/banip status *": [
"exec"
]
},
"uci": [
"banip"
]
}
}
}